    Ait Ben Haddou Kasbah

    On this first day, travellers will discover one of Morocco’s jewels: the Kasbah of Aït Benhaddou,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Your adventure begins with a journey through the High Atlas Mountains, through spectacular scenery, green valleys and the famous Tizi n’Tichka Pass, one of the highest in the country. In Aït Benhaddou, you will explore an ancestral Ksar composed of adobe houses, authentic alleys and exceptional viewpoints. It’s a real cinema setting where Gladiator, Game of Thrones, Laurence of Arabia, The Mummy, and many other international productions have been shot.
